Colorful Expression

The Art Institute of Chicago's exhibition "Becoming Edvard Munch: Influence, Anxiety, and Myth" includes plenty of the swirling, eerily beautiful images that the Norwegian Expressionist is best known for, such as his masterpiece The Scream, but also many brighter, more literal scenes of late-19th-century life. They are juxtaposed with works by his contemporaries, including Monet, revealing some surprising parallels. (2/14-4/26; artic.edu)

Here Gomes the Fun

"Do something funny for money" was the philanthropic dictum issued to designer Stella McCartney, who created limited-edition T-shirts to benefit Comic Relief, a charity movement that helps Brits and Africans living in dire poverty. U.K. retailer TK Maxx will exclusively distribute the tees, which feature clownish red noses superimposed on celebrated people and cuddly animals. Thanks to such humanitarian efforts from the Beatles' progeny and other big hearts like hers, maybe money can buy love, (rednoseday.com)

Bulgari Benefits

Bulgari, with help from such friends as Sally Field, Ben Stiller, and Julianne Moore, celebrates its 125th anniversary with a limited-edition silver ring honoring the company's founder, Sotirio Bulgari. A portion of the proceeds will benefit Save the Children's Rewrite the Future campaign, devoted to education, (bulgari.com)

Fantasy Ride

After more than 70 years of automotive superstardom, the Phantom Corsair will be making a rare appearance this month, at the 14th annual Amelia Island Concours d'Elegance, Florida's high-octane carnival of vintage hatchbacks and hardtops. (3/13-3/15; ameliaconcours.org)
